People that register in debt relief programs have, generally, approximately $28,000 of unsafe financial obligation throughout almost 7 accounts, according to an analysis commissioned by the American Association for Debt Resolution, which took a look at customers of 10 significant financial obligation alleviation companies between 2011 and 2020. About three-quarters of those customers contended the very least one financial obligation account efficiently worked out, with the regular enrollee resolving 3.8 accounts and more than fifty percent of their registered debt.

It's common for your credit report to drop when you first start the financial obligation alleviation process, specifically if you quit paying to your lenders. As each financial obligation is cleared up, your credit history must start to rebound. Make certain you comprehend the complete expenses and the result on your credit report when assessing if financial obligation settlement is the ideal choice.

Right here's how each one works: Financial obligation combination finances: These are individual finances that you can use to resolve your existing financial debts, leaving you with just one month-to-month expense, commonly at a reduced rate of interest. Equilibrium transfer credit scores cards: This includes moving your existing bank card balances to a brand-new bank card that supplies a reduced interest price or a promotional 0% APR for a collection duration.

When the period finishes, rates of interest will be considerably high usually over 20%. Home equity loans or HELOCs (home equity credit lines): These lendings enable you to borrow against the equity in your house. You receive a swelling amount or a line of credit rating that can be made use of to pay off financial debts, and you typically take advantage of lower rates of interest contrasted to unsafe lendings.

The catch is that not-for-profit Charge card Financial obligation Forgiveness isn't for every person. To qualify, you must not have actually made a payment on your credit card account, or accounts, for 120-180 days. On top of that, not all lenders take part, and it's just provided by a few nonprofit credit scores counseling companies. InCharge Debt Solutions is just one of them.

The Debt Card Mercy Program is for individuals that are so far behind on debt card payments that they are in severe economic difficulty, potentially facing insolvency, and don't have the income to capture up."The program is particularly designed to assist clients whose accounts have been charged off," Mostafa Imakhchachen, consumer care specialist at InCharge Financial obligation Solutions, said.

Creditors who get involved have actually concurred with the nonprofit credit report counseling company to approve 50%-60% of what is owed in taken care of regular monthly settlements over 36 months. The set payments imply you recognize precisely just how much you'll pay over the repayment duration. No interest is charged on the balances during the benefit period, so the settlements and amount owed don't transform.
